What companies run services between Ithaca, Ionian Islands, Greece and Brindisi, Italy?

There is no direct connection from Ithaca to Brindisi. However, you can take the ferry to Sami, take the taxi to Kefalonia Airport (EFL) airport, then fly to Brindisi Airport (BDS). Alternatively, you can take a vehicle from Itháki to Brindisi via Pisaetós, Astakós, Port of Vlora, and Porto Di Brindisi in around 14h 27m.
